I bought "Woman, Thou Art Loosed! Devotional" in 1999 at a book sale at my company and it sat on my bookcase for nearly a year unread and collecting dust until Thanksgiving 2000. At the time, I was in a spiritual valley, full of self-pity and doubt. I do believe God guided me to take Bishop Jakes' book out and read it. Sisters, I read it TWICE that weekend, and became renewed, refreshed, and redeemed. Chapter 16, "Dealing with Your Cains and Abels," was especially uplifting for me personally because Bishop Jakes showed how I was blocking my blessings by continuing to cling to the past and certain individuals in it. Bishop Jakes' spiritual gift, to tap into those who are hurting and need encouragement, is evident throughout this book. Buy it!

T. D. Jakes is part church pastor and part psychologist/philosopher. Or that is how he can appear in his writings and talks such is his knowledge of human nature and the inner workings of life and sociology.
The writings of T. D. Jakes are of real life stuff. Down-to-earth, common sense talk and the making of easy sense from rhetorical and complicated matters are a few of the watermarks of a T. D. Jakes book. His messages are geared towards hope and healing, filled with wisdom, empathy and love. Nothing is difficult to figure out or weed through while T. D. Jakes is at the helm. Just two sentences from a chapter of this book: "Sin is how we medicate the need we have for validation. It's how we numb our pain." He is unafraid of telling anything as it is. Jakes has a gift in seeing and unraveling the smallest threads with ease. A friend gave me this book after she found out how much I enjoyed another T.D. Jakes book. I plan to pass this book along to another friend and buy the rest of Mr. Jakes' books. This author is one of my favorites now.
